"Udo" (Peace) is a fusion of Afrosurrealism and Igbo heritage. The subject’s luminous green skin reimagines peace as a vibrant, living force, set against a rhythmic backdrop of Uli and Nsibidi-inspired geometric patterns. This striking contrast between cool, ethereal tones and warm, high-energy oranges creates a visual equilibrium that honors ancestral roots through a modern, avant-garde lens.
The quality of the work is defined by its captivating gaze and intricate texture. The deliberate white line work and heavy, red textured collar ground the figure, creating a harmonious balance between spiritual depth and physical presence. Ultimately, “Udo” is a compelling exploration of identity, effectively translating a complex cultural concept into a universal language of quiet, commanding dignity.
